Solana’s DeFi Revolution: The Rise of Private DEXs and Institutional Confidence

In recent months, Solana (SOL) has surged back into the spotlight, particularly within its decentralized finance (DeFi) ecosystem. A significant change is underway as private decentralized exchanges (DEXs) are now dominating the landscape, bringing about a new level of efficiency with vault-based execution methods. The transformation is highlighted by a staggering increase in trading volumes: in the first quarter of 2025 alone, spot DEX volumes on Solana skyrocketed to $180 billion, a 62% improvement from the previous quarter. This surge points toward a fundamental shift in how DeFi operates on Solana, signaling optimism about its future potential.

Private DEXs, such as SolFi, Obric v2, and ZeroFi, have emerged as key players, processing between 40% to 60% of trades routed through Jupiter, Solana’s leading DEX aggregator. These platforms diverge from traditional public DEXs by employing smart contracts and internal vaults, effectively streamlining trade executions with tighter spreads and minimized exposure. According to a recent report from Pine Analytics, "Their routing share reflects performance, not branding," illustrating how these DEXs are reshaping the trading landscape by delivering high reliability and optimized performance.

These private DEXs specialize in selective token pairs, mainly SOL along with stablecoins like USDC and USDT, focusing on stability and reliable pricing data. Platforms like Obric v2 and ZeroFi prioritize trading efficiency with high-confidence tokens. Meanwhile, SolFi targets the fast-paced world of newly launched tokens and memecoins, highlighting how these DEXs adapt to the volatility often seen in this segment. The integration of aggregator-only execution, coupled with real-time oracle-based pricing and vault-managed liquidity, further enhances their capability to navigate the ever-shifting landscape of crypto assets.

Despite the advantages that private DEXs provide, it is crucial to recognize the downsides associated with their rise. While they leverage Solana’s high throughput, they fall short in ensuring transparency and interoperability—two foundational principles of decentralized finance. The emergence of private execution vaults has diminished the openness once characteristic of DeFi, prompting concerns over visibility into trade execution and protocol interactions. Experts argue that in order for Solana to maintain its competitive edge, upcoming network upgrades will need to enable more secure and efficient public quoting. Until such improvements are made, private DEXs are likely to maintain their significant role within the ecosystem.

Meanwhile, institutional interest in Solana is climbing, signalling a robust vote of confidence in the platform’s future. The recent acquisition by DeFi Development Corp. of over 172,000 SOL, valued at approximately $23.6 million, sets a new benchmark for institutional engagement. As revealed in an SEC filing, this organization aims to raise $1 billion through securities sales specifically to amass Solana tokens. Coupled with a recent Coinbase report indicating that $42 million has already been secured for SOL acquisitions, it is clear institutional players are looking to capitalize on Solana’s growth potential.

Amidst this bullish sentiment, Solana’s technical indicators show strong momentum, with the token recently soaring to a price of $180.97. However, the Relative Strength Index (RSI) suggests that it may be overbought, potentially signaling an impending short-term correction. Despite these signs, Solana is becoming increasingly appealing for buyers as the utility and market dynamics continue to evolve. The SOL/ETH trading pair demonstrates remarkable resilience, maintaining significant support despite broader market fluctuations surrounding Ethereum and its ETF developments.
